Flower Victims Poem by Saiom Shriver

Flower Victims



Mowers decapitate them.
Salad lovers behead them
Lovers shred them petal by petal.
Flower arrangers and artists
position their dead bodies.
Bees steal their nectar and abandon them.
Perfumers cut them to extract their smells.
